Frequently Asked Questions About Stinging Nettle Plants
- How big will the Stinging Nettle Plants get? Stinging Nettle Plants (Urtica Dioica) can grow between 2 to 4 feet tall, depending on the growing conditions and soil fertility.
- What type of soil is best for Stinging Nettle? Stinging Nettle thrives in well-drained soil that is rich in nutrients. Amending your soil with compost before planting is highly recommended.
- How much sunlight does Stinging Nettle need? Urtica Dioica prefers partial to full sunlight, requiring at least 4 to 6 hours of direct sunlight each day for optimal growth.
- When is the best time to transplant the bare roots? The ideal time to transplant Stinging Nettle bare roots is in early spring or late fall, when the weather is mild and the soil is moist.
- How do I handle Stinging Nettle safely? Always wear gloves and long sleeves when handling Stinging Nettle to avoid skin irritation from the stinging hairs. The stinging sensation disappears when the plant is cooked or dried.
